Here are some of my favorite categories and ideas for naming your ginger-colored companion:
1. Food-Inspired & Spicy Delights:
These names are often adorable and have a comforting ring to them.
Gingerbread: Just like my girl! So sweet and classic.
Cinnamon: Perfect for a warm, reddish-brown coat.
Nutmeg: Unique and cozy.
Paprika: For a dog with a bit of spice and zest!
Saffron: A beautiful, exotic spice name.
Muffin: If your dog is as sweet as a baked treat.
Honey: For a truly golden-hearted pup.
2. Nature & Earthy Tones:
Think of all the beautiful reddish-brown hues found in nature.
Autumn: Ideal for a dog born in fall or with autumnal colors.
Rusty: A classic for a reddish-brown dog, often full of character.
Copper: For that shiny, metallic ginger sheen.
Blaze: If your dog has a fiery spirit or markings.
Sunny: For a bright, cheerful ginger pup that brings sunshine into your life.
Phoenix: A powerful name for a dog with a vibrant, fiery coat.
3. Sweet & Playful Nicknames:
Sometimes the best names are the short, cute ones that just roll off the tongue.
Gi Gi: One of my go-to nicknames for my Ginger! So easy and affectionate.
Red: Simple, direct, and charming.
Goldie: For a lighter ginger or golden-red coat.
Sunny: (Worth mentioning twice!) Always a winner.
Carrot: A quirky and cute option!
4. Literary & Pop Culture Inspired:
If you're a fan of stories, there are some great ginger-haired characters to draw inspiration from.
Ginny: From Harry Potter, known for her vibrant red hair.
Ron: Another beloved ginger from the wizarding world.
Merida: The brave, fiery-haired princess from 'Brave'.
Anne: From 'Anne of Green Gables', famous for her red hair and spirited personality.
Pippi (Longstocking): For a truly adventurous and strong-willed ginger pup.
When you're making your final choice, say the name out loud a few times. Does it feel right? Is it easy to call? Most importantly, does it feel like your dog's name?
